Abstract

This paper proposes an optimal passive PID (OP-PID) controller of permanent magnetic synchronous generator (PMSG) for maximum power point tracking (MPPT), in which the interactive teaching-learning optimizer (ITLO) is employed to tune the optimal PID control parameters. A storage function is firstly constructed while the beneficial terms are retained by carefully investigating the physical meaning of each term. Then, a PID controller is adopted on the passivized system as an additional input, which parameters are optimally tuned via ITLO. Case studies on step change of wind speed and stochastic wind speed variation verify the effectiveness of the proposed method in comparison to that of PID controller and feedback linearization control (FLC).
